High production of electricity

After two years with production of electricity below normal the production of electric energy has been higher so far this year. In April the production of electricity was 10 809 GWh - 36.6 per cent higher than April last year. The production in the period January - April 2005 was 23.1 per cent higher than in the same period last year and almost as high as in the record high year 2000.

In April the net export (export minus import) of electricity from Norway was 597 GWh. So far this year the net exports have been 4 008 GWh while the net imports were 3 961 GWh in the same period last year.

The gross domestic consumption of electricity in April this year amounted to 10 212 GWh whilst the consumption in the period January - April came to 47 218 GWh. The consumption of electricity in the energy-intensive manufacturing industries was 2 871 GWh, and is the highest rlevel ever recorded for April.
